Use the built-in Photos app to add a watermark

Here’s how to set a watermark to your images:

1) Open the image in the iPhone or iPad Photos app and tap Edit.

2) Tap the markup button.

3) Tap the tiny plus button (+) and choose Signature (or Text).

4) Use your finger to sign and tap Done.

5) Position the signature wherever you want on the image. Use two fingers to change the size of the signature watermark. Tap the color palette icon to change the color of the signature.

6) Finally, tap Done > Done to save the image with your signature watermark.

How do I add a watermark in Apple Photos?

This method is easy to use, you don’t have to download any additional app, the signature is saved for all future use, and you can easily revert the change. The drawback is that you can’t use a logo or image as a watermark.

Add watermark with dedicated iPhone and iPad apps

I tested around two dozen watermark apps from the App Store. And out of those, I found six suitable for adding watermark without much hassle. Here are the steps for one of the easiest apps, and after that, the names of five other watermark apps and their highlighted features.

Follow these steps to add text, signature, or a logo watermark to images on iPhone or iPad:

1) Download the Logo Watermark app from the App Store and open it.

2) Tap for image and pick a picture from the Photos app.

3) From the top right:

  • Select for add logo to insert your logo (or image) as the watermark.
  • Choose for signature and use your finger to add a sign. Use the color box to change the signature color. If you would like to use it in the future, enable Save to default signature.
  • Tap Text here to add custom text or use the copyright and other symbols. After typing the text, use Aa and the color dot to change the font and color.

4) To change the opacity and size of the logo, signature, or text, tap it and drag the slider.

5) Position the watermark to the desired spot on the image. Once done, select Export to save the image with the added watermark to your iOS Photos app.

5 iPhone apps to add watermark to images

1) Watermark Video – Add Watermark: This is among the best apps that lets you create eye-catching watermarks. You can also use this to add a watermark in batches! The only downside is that positioning the watermark to a corner takes some practice. Overall, it’s an excellent app.

2) eZy Watermark: Add an image, text, signature, date & time, and more as the watermark. It also lets you save your signature as a template and change export file quality (from the app’s settings).

3) Watermark – Add Watermark: You can add text, logo, or another image as the watermark. It also supports batch edits which lets you add the same watermark to multiple images in one go.

4) Watermark: It’s very simple to use with not many options. You can only add a text-based watermark and choose from one of the nine locations to position the watermark.

5) Watermark Maker: Just enter the text and the app will create some beautiful watermarks for you. You can export the watermark to the Photos app or add it to an image. Be aware, the app doesn’t allow signature or logo-based watermarks. Plus, it requires an in-app purchase ($2.99) to export unlimited images.

How do I add a watermark to my Photos on my iPhone?

Open Photos and choose a photo you want to watermark. Tap Edit. Tap the three dots in the upper right corner of your screen and choose Markup. From the bottom menu, choose how you want to add your watermark.
